Core Tip |
This case report details the rare co-occurrence of oligodendroglioma and arteriovenous malformation in a 61-year-old male. Preoperative multimodal imaging, including computed tomography, magnetic resonance imaging, magnetic resonance spectroscopy, digital subtraction angiography, and computed tomography angiography, was crucial in accurately diagnosing the combined pathology, guiding the successful surgical removal. This study underscores the importance of comprehensive imaging to prevent misdiagnosis and highlights the feasibility of craniotomy for treating this rare condition. |
